Thanks. I actually ran a thin wire to the release pin so I could manually pull it from inside the trunk until I find a replacement.
UPDATE:
I found a replacement Fuel Door Actuator
Part #78850AL500 for $67. It will take 5 minutes to replace.

This happened to me one time. I took my g/f's '03 G Coupe out and it needed gas the light was on.
I pulled into the gas station and start pressing the fuel door it's not popping open. Now I'm in a semi-panic feeling like a complete idiot cause I can't get the fuel door open. I call the g/f.
We both work at Carmax. She had this happen to her on a G sedan. For 15 minutes she and a few other people couldn't figure out how to get it to open, and then somebody decided to hit the unlock button and it popped open. I completely forgot about it and she suggested it and it popped open.
Still not quite sure why the car has that feature.
